How does Wheat Ridge, CO compare to Lafayette, CO? Wheat Ridge has a population of 32,158 with a median household income of $87,598, while Lafayette has 30,471 residents and a median income of $110,431.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Wheat Ridge, CO | Lafayette, CO |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 32,158 | 30,471 | +5.5% |
| Median Age | 42.1 | 39.4 | +6.9% |
| Foreign Born % | 4.6% | 10.6% | -56.6% |
| Metric | Wheat Ridge | Lafayette |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$87,598 | $110,431 | -20.7% |
| Unemployment | 4.8% | 3.8% | +26.3% |
| Poverty Rate | 10.2% | 6.1% | +67.2% |
| Bachelor's+ | 44.4% | 65.6% | -32.3% |
| Metric | Wheat Ridge | Lafayette |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$584,700 | $647,600 | -9.7% |
| Median Rent | $1493/mo | $2042/mo | -26.9% |
| Housing Units | 15,805 | 13,323 | +18.6% |
